If you’re ever stuck, just remember that the apostrophe indicates the connecting of two words into one to contract them (you are > you’re).
To use you're and your correctly, remember that you're is short for you are, and your is used to show ownership, like in your house. if you don't know which one to use, try writing you are instead. Your is the second person possessive determiner Your can refer to one or more people.
